Every hotel seems to have its ghost story. But only one hotel was the inspiration for one of the most iconic ghost stories ... of all time. In 1974, Stephen King checked into room 217 of the Stanley Hotel in Estes Park, Colorado. It only took one night in that infamously haunted room, and one vivid nightmare, for King to come up with the bones for The Shining. Today, the Stanley Hotel has earned a reputation as one of the most haunted hotels in the world... and according to staff and visitors... the spirits that haunt this building... are no work of fiction.
